我正在为iOS应用开发一个简单的用户界面。 我所做的就是将其开发成一个表视图,其中有一个与之关联的导航控制器,并将其放置在Storyboard中。
除了导航栏意外地覆盖了视图的标题栏“点击选择项目”外,一切似乎都运行正常,如下图所示。
我该如何完全摆脱这个?
答案 0 :(得分:1)
在Interface Builder中,选择视图控制器,然后在属性检查器上关闭布局:想要全屏。然后,您的布局将自动调整其大小,以便为导航栏腾出空间。
答案 1 :(得分:0)
在viewDidLoad方法中添加此代码
self.navigationController?.navigationBar.translucent = false
它对我有用,因为你和我有同样的问题,我认为它也适合你。
答案 2 :(得分:-1)
你想要隐藏导航栏使用这一行
self.navigationController.hidden = YES;